PT-2022-16904 · Unknown · Smokescreen

Grzegorz Niedziela

·

Publicado

2022-04-07

·

Atualizado

2024-08-21

·

CVE-2022-24825

CVSS v3.1

5.8

Média

VetorAV:N/AC:L/PR:N/UI:N/S:C/C:L/I:N/A:N
Nome do software vulnerável e versões afetadas
Versões do Smokescreen anteriores à 0.0.3
Descrição
O Smokescreen é um proxy HTTP simples projetado para impedir ataques de falsificação de solicitação do lado do servidor (SSRF), bloqueando o acesso a determinados URLs. Ele também possui uma lista de restrições para limitar o acesso a outros URLs. No entanto, foi descoberta uma falha que permitia que invasores contornassem a lista de restrições adicionando um ponto ao final de URLs fornecidas pelo usuário ou inserindo dados com letras maiúsculas e minúsculas diferentes. Isso poderia permitir que invasores externos aproveitassem o comportamento de aplicativos para se conectar ou escanear a infraestrutura interna.
Recomendações
Atualize o Smokescreen para a versão 0.0.3 ou posterior. Como solução temporária, considere restringir o acesso ao recurso de lista de restrições até que o problema seja resolvido. Além disso, tenha cuidado ao lidar com URLs fornecidas pelo usuário para minimizar o risco de exploração.

Exploit

Correção

SSRF

Encontrou algum problema na descrição? Tem algo a acrescentar? Fique à vontade para nos escrever 👾

Enumeração de Fraquezas

Identificadores relacionados

CVE-2022-24825
GHSA-GCJ7-J438-HJJ2
GO-2022-0429

Produtos afetados

Smokescreen